Bluetooth be created, licensed and developed by a company called Bluetooth Special Interest Group. The companies Ericsson, IBM, Intel, Toshiba, and Nokia formed a consortium and adopt the code name Bluetooth contained by 1998.

Ericsson be where the launch of Bluetooth was created, however the unproved concept was not for mobile phones, it be for office environments at the time, so that mobile workers could use printers and LAN services lacking the need for added infrastructure - Some want redundant as WLAN was only around the corner and faster.

Ericsson always maintain that the code for bluetooth would be open source, and next later as some one have said a consortium was set up.

Bluetooth itself is not a device, and as such cannot be aid to have be invented in the conventional sense. Rather, it is a set of protocols - a set of agreed settings on an electronic device, which see it to communicate with other devices.

In this mode, it is a bit like proverb 'who invented language' - no-one did. It just developed as ethnic group agreed on words to specify different meanings or objects - so long as everyone uses like peas in a pod words, people can communicate.

It is equal with bluetooth - so long as two devices are using indistinguishable settings, the devices can communicate.

Also, again drawing comparison to language, at hand are different bluetooth 'profiles', which could be compared to different languages surrounded by different countries. To be able to communicate, the two devices want to be using the same profile, or they won't know each other

However, within answer to your question, the company that developed the model was a nouns branch of LM Ericsson (now merged with Sony to become SonyEricsson).

They developed the conception in the hasty 90's, and contacted a number of companies within 1995 to see if they would be interested in using duplicate settings (to continue my closer metaphor, this would be a bit like one being at a multilingual meeting suggesting that for this jamboree, we should all speak english so we can adjectives understand respectively other).

These companies, which included Nokia, IBM and Intel as the major players, agreed, and set up a conglomerate agreed as the SIG, who formalized an licenced the agreed settings and profiles, and started to use them in the consumer marketplace by the late 90's
